Elevate your wedding look with the White Rose Groom Buttonhole from Flowers Fortis Green. This elegant design features a single premium white rose paired with delicate gypsophila and finished with an aralia leaf for a fresh, refined touch. Hand-tied with a white satin ribbon, it sits beautifully on any style of wedding suit, from classic tuxedos to modern tailored jackets.

Perfect for grooms, best men, and groomsmen, this white rose buttonhole adds a timeless, romantic detail to your big day. Each piece is handcrafted with care by our skilled florists in Fortis Green, ensuring quality, consistency, and a polished finish in every buttonhole.

Ideal for traditional, modern, or minimalist weddings, this white rose and gypsophila combination photographs beautifully and complements most colour schemes. The price includes a set of 4 buttonholes, making it easy to coordinate your wedding party.
